How much can a Ford F-150 tow?

The towing capacity of a Ford F-150 can vary depending on the specific model, engine, and equipment. When properly equipped, the Ford F-150 is capable of towing medium-sized boats, campers, livestock, and trailers. The towing capacity can range from 5,000 pounds to 14,000 pounds. The capacity is influenced by factors such as the powertrain, gear ratios, suspension, box length, and frame construction. For example, a regular cab 2022 Ford F-150 with a 3.5L EcoBoost V-6 engine can tow up to 14,000 pounds.
It’s important to note that the towing capacity can also be affected by other factors such as payload, cab configuration, drivetrain, and the presence of a tow package. To determine the exact towing capacity for a specific Ford F-150 model, it is recommended to consult the owner’s manual or contact a Ford dealer with the vehicle’s serial number.

How heavy of a camper can a F-150 pull?

With a turbocharged 3.5L EcoBoost® V6 engine, the F-150 can tow up to 14,000 pounds (8,200 pounds on Raptor). As strong as the F-150 is, exceeding the recommended towing capacity of the truck can lead to serious repercussions on the road.

What F-150 can tow 13,000 lbs?

If you want to achieve the highest Ford F-150 towing capacity, the 3.5-liter EcoBoost V-6 engine will be the best choice for your truck. With the 3.5-liter EcoBoost V-6 engine, your F-150 towing capacity will range from 11,000 pounds1 to a best-in-class 13,500 pounds3 with the Max Trailer Tow Package.

What is the max tow package on F-150?

The Max Trailer Tow Package is the only way to unlock the maximum 14,000-pound towing capacity of the 2023 Ford F-150. It’s the most towing capability you can get out of the 2023 Ford F-150 before moving up to the Ford F-150 Super Duty.
